Abstract: The disciplines of system management and security can be considered two sides of the same IT coin when it comes to endpoints. System management ensures that systems are configured, patched, and operating correctly, and security keeps threats and vulnerabilities from compromising the system. The upcoming release of Microsoft Forefront Endpoint Protection 2010 is built on Microsoft System Center Configuration Manager to deliver high levels of protection and productivity. Abstract: With the release of the Windows 7 operating system, new capabilities, working scenarios, and efficiencies are emerging. In the area of green IT, Windows 7 contains new features that, when combined with Microsoft System Center, drive the reduction of operational costs through centrally controlled power management. In this webcast, we describe the enterprise-class power management capabilities that were introduced in the newly released Microsoft System Center Configuration Manager 2007 Service Pack 2 (SP2) and Configuration Manager 2007 R3. From integration with Intel vPro technology, to power management planning, to centrally controlled policy application, to industry-standard reporting formats, join us to learn why Configuration Manager should be your technology of choice to help reduce energy costs.

Abstract: With a 21,000-server footprint across production and managed labs, Microsoft uses the System Center product suite to efficiently manage the datacenter. Asset inventory, security compliance, and service monitoring are the key services that Microsoft IT provides for datacenter platform customers.
